Will a Bartholin's gland cyst heal without treatment?

Bartholin's gland cysts usually do not completely disappear on their own, especially if an infection or abscess has formed. It may cause further discomfort or even worsen the condition. It is recommended to seek medical treatment promptly.

The Bartholin's glands are part of the female reproductive system and are responsible for secreting lubricating fluid. Once the gland's outlet is blocked, the secreted fluid cannot be discharged, and a cyst will form. In most cases, the cyst is painless in the early stages, but when it grows in size or becomes infected, it may cause pain, swelling, and difficulty walking.

Small uninfected cysts may be stable in the short term, but once symptoms such as redness, swelling, heat and pain appear, it may be caused by infection and abscess formation, which may affect daily life and health. Delaying treatment may further aggravate the infection and even cause fistulas or recurrence of cysts. Some people think that cysts are temporarily painless and itchy and ignore them, but negligence may complicate the condition.

Keeping the area clean and avoiding long periods of sitting or wearing tight clothing can help reduce the risk of glandular obstruction. When symptoms of infection appear, you should go to a professional institution for examination and treatment as soon as possible. The doctor may choose medication, incision and drainage, or other methods according to the situation. It is not recommended to try to puncture the cyst by yourself to avoid secondary infection.
